TODAY'S FORECAST FOR PITLOCHRY
There's been an unusually large temperature range, between 20.9 yesterday & 0.1 overnight, indicative of dry air, clear sky & just about calm conditions. A similar day to Sunday is expected--chilly to start with, but quickly warming up by late morning, with long spells of sunshine. Top temperature should be similar to yesterday, in a range 19 to 21 degrees, with light breezes. TONIGHT will be mainly clear & ending up cold.

YESTERDAY IN PITLOCHRYA chilly start ended up as a record-breaking day for warmth, as the late afternoon temperature reached 20.9. FYVIE CASTLE broke the Scottish all time record by reaching 22.8.  But what will today bring?
THE GENERAL WEATHER PATTERN AROUND THE BRITISH ISLES
An anticyclone continues to dominate Britain's weather & it is expected to remain dry for several days yet. However, the high pressure will gradually migrate further west & this will allow cooler air to invade from the NW.
TOMORROW'S FORECAST FOR PITLOCHRYAnother dry & sunny day. It will again start cold & misty, but afternoon temperatures should again be well above average & in the range 18 to 20 degrees.
